Overview
- Johanna San Miguel, a guest on the program, made derogatory remarks about Anthony “Tonino” Alencastre’s body after being shown his photo.
- Viewers criticized the hosts of Habla Good for laughing and not stopping the exchange, and colleague Curwen publicly condemned the moment.
- Irivarren apologized on Good Time alongside Laura Spoya and Gerardo Pe, saying the team will not justify or minimize what happened.
- He described a personal “mea culpa,” explaining he initially treated the comments as a joke and later recognized that normalizing such talk was wrong.
- The episode continues to draw online backlash across Peru, and San Miguel has not issued a public response so far.
